Dr. René Windiks has been invited to speak at the online event, "Solid-State Batteries: Innovations, Promising Start-Ups, & Future Roadmap." The event, hosted by TechBlick on https://www.techblick.com/event/solid_state_batteries, is scheduled for Thursday, February 15, 2024, from 3:45 to 4:15 pm CET.
Â
Dr. Windiks, an expert in batteries and atomistic scale modeling, will discuss "Advancing Battery Materials through Atomistic Scale Modeling." His talk aims to reveal insights into the developments in battery materials.
Â
The event will explore themes such as Solid State Batteries, Beyond Li-Ion technologies, and Battery Materials starting February 14, 2024. Dr. Windiks' contribution is expected to highlight the potential of atomistic scale modeling in battery technology.
